Toto Wolff demands transparency in Christian Horner misconduct investigation

Mercedes Formula 1 chief Toto Wolff and McLaren F1 boss Zak Brown have jointly advocated for increased openness regarding Red Bull's probe into Christian Horner. Horner, the principal of Red Bull's team, was exonerated by the parent company after an external inquiry into accusations concerning his behaviour. The decision was communicated through a succinct statement from Red Bull GmbH, stating that an unspecified 'grievance' had been 'dismissed'. The statement further noted the report's confidentiality due to the involvement of various parties and third parties and thus refrained from additional comments 'out of respect for all concerned'.
